VeloDB Cloud
SQL Manual
Functions
aggregate-functions
group_bitmap_xor

GROUP_BITMAP_XOR

Description

Syntax:

BITMAP GROUP_BITMAP_XOR(expr)

This function performs an xor calculation on expr, and returns a new bitmap.

Example

mysql>  select page, bitmap_to_string(user_id) from pv_bitmap;
+------+-----------------------------+
| page | bitmap_to_string(`user_id`) |
+------+-----------------------------+
| m    | 4,7,8                       |
| m    | 1,3,6,15                    |
| m    | 4,7                         |
+------+-----------------------------+

mysql> select page, bitmap_to_string(group_bitmap_xor(user_id)) from pv_bitmap group by page;
+------+-----------------------------------------------+
| page | bitmap_to_string(group_bitmap_xor(`user_id`)) |
+------+-----------------------------------------------+
| m    | 1,3,6,8,15                                    |
+------+-----------------------------------------------+

Keywords

GROUP_BITMAP_XOR,BITMAP